Anna Kournikova

Anna Sergeyevna Kournikova was Anna Sergeyevna Kournikova was a Russian tennis professional and American TV personality. Her popularity and appearance has made her one the most well-known tennis players around the world. Anna Kournikova, a Russian tennis player who at one time had the distinction of being the most famous female athlete in the sport. Kournikova, a modestly talented singles tennis player, was a phenomenal doubles tennis player. The partnership she formed along with Martina Hingis received widespread praise for the effectiveness of their partnership. With her modeling and her appearance, she was famous worldwide. In the present Kournikova still ranks among the most searched-for athletes on the internet. Kournikova was singles and an advanced baseliner who moved the ball with speed and bounce around the court. She was renowned for her powerful returns as well as groundstrokes. Kournikova's father and mother, both professionals themselves, were born in Moscow. Sergei Kournikov took home the world wrestling championships while Alla Kournikova was a runner. Kournikova first started playing tennis at the age of five, and then moved to Florida in the year 1991 (at 10 years old) ten) to study at the Nick Bollettieri Academy. As a pro, she signed endorsement deals with a whole bunch of brands, and quickly became the poster girl of tennis for women. Following her retirement, Kournikova retains a significant audience and has also appeared in Hollywood movies. Kournikova is in a long-term relationship and Enrique Iglesias, a global star. They have two kids twins that were born in December 2017. Anna Sergeyevna Kurnikova is a Russian SFSR Soviet Union born 7 June in 1981. She is an Russian ex-professional tennis player. She first made her appearance in professional tennis in the age of 14 becoming the youngest ever player to win and participate in the Fed Cup for Russia. At 15 years old, she made it to the U.S Open and managed to make it up to the semifinals at Wimbledon. However, she was forced to withdraw from tennis professionally at the age of 21 due to severe back problems.
